Btw, you will almost always receive blueprints after a story quest is done, except for some which give all the components to build (Limbo, Mirage, Inaros, I don't know which else). You can build warframes with the foundry, but first you need the 3 components (neuroptics, chasis and systems) and the blueprint. Gara, for example, you can farm her components with Cetus' contracts, but for the moment I advice to leave the open worlds for later as enemies, in your current level, will destroy you (trust me on that). You can get a Hildryn Prime set for quite cheap from other players, if you want. She's been available for farming for a while now, so many players are overflowing with them. Heck, I have one I don't have a use for, if you want. As for all of the weapons, you can get their blueprints for credits, and you can have several things building in parallel in the foundry. It takes 12h~24h to build a weapon, so it's a good idea to always have a couple of things running. Forma blueprints become readily available later on (and in a week or so they will be even more), and they're really useful to min/max weapons and warframes, so people will tell you to Always Be Building Forma, since you can only craft one per day with the whole delay thingy. You didn't show it in the video, but the mods you put on the weapon makes it a lot more powerful. Prefer quality over quantity for mods: many un-leveled mods will give you less damage than a few, leveled-up mods. There's this annoying system where you can double the mod capacity of a weapon/warframe by investing an item in it, but you only find/get that item every few weeks. The Dex Nikana you got has that item installed in it for free, so hold onto it :) Have fun with the game!
